About the Story

The suspense begun in Adventure #10 now comes to an incredible conclusion with SAVAGE ISLAND PART II! This Adventure requires you to have successfully finished #10, wherein you were given the secret password to begin this final half.
Converted from original code by Paul David Doherty.

A super-hard Scott Adams adventure in space, June 5, 2017

In this game, you play the second half of the first Savage Island. The first Savage Island was really hard, but this one is much harder.

It's hard to survive past the first two moves, as you must discover how to survive a vacuum. Beyond that, it just keeps getting harder, as you experience things that have to be searched on several levels, unusual verbs and unusual ways to use objects, and more vacuum-based time limits.

Overall, though, it has a much more coherent story than some other Scott Adams games.
